The Impact of On-Demand Delivery on Retail
On-demand delivery services have bridged the gap between instant gratification and convenience, reshaping consumer expectations and retail strategies.
Key Changes in Retail:
- Increased Consumer Expectations: Customers now expect faster, more flexible delivery options.
- Retailer Adaptation: Retailers are redesigning their supply chain and inventory management to cater to immediate delivery demands.
- Technological Integration: Advanced technologies like AI and IoT are being employed to streamline the delivery process.
The Future of Retail and On-Demand Delivery
The future of retail is intrinsically linked to the evolution of on-demand delivery services. Here's what to look out for:
- Sustainable Delivery Solutions: Eco-friendly delivery options are becoming increasingly important.
- Localized Warehousing: Retailers are setting up mini-warehouses in urban areas to expedite delivery.
- Personalized Shopping Experiences: AI-driven recommendations and custom delivery options are enhancing the shopping experience.
